Why is obedience to parents important for children?

Obedience to parents is crucial as it aligns with God's ordained authority and impacts a child's spiritual well-being.

Obedience to parents is essential as it is not merely a social norm but a divine command that reflects an understanding of God’s authority. Ephesians 6:1 asserts that children should obey their parents in the Lord. This obedience signifies respect and acknowledgment of God's established order. Disobedience, as highlighted in Proverbs 28:24, is spiritually dangerous, not only for children but can lead to greater societal issues as it undermines authority. Therefore, teaching and modeling obedience is vital for the spiritual health of children and the family at large.
Scripture References: Ephesians 6:1, Proverbs 28:24
